# Background: The Crypto Landscape in India
The Indian cryptocurrency space has been on a rollercoaster ride, marked by extreme volatility and regulatory uncertainty. With more than 15 million crypto investors in India, the market has seen significant growth despite challenges. The Reserve Bank of India (RBI) has maintained a cautious stance on cryptocurrencies, yet the Securities and Exchange Board of India (SEBI) has been working to create a conducive regulatory framework. Amidst this backdrop, innovations in security protocols are increasingly relevant as investors seek safe avenues for their digital assets.
# What Happened: Introduction of Mythos
Recently, Anthropic, a prominent AI research company, unveiled its latest model, Mythos, aimed at reshaping security protocols in the crypto industry. This advanced model leverages artificial intelligence to enhance the security of blockchain technologies and create more secure frameworks for crypto trading and transactions. Mythos has been designed to address vulnerabilities that have plagued the crypto sector, particularly in the wake of hacks and scams that have led to billions in losses across the globe.
The model's introduction comes at a crucial time when the industry is grappling with increasing regulatory scrutiny and demands for improved security protocols. According to a report by Chainalysis, losses from crypto hacks reached $3.8 billion in 2022, underscoring the urgent need for robust security solutions.
